12 Dog Washing Station in Laundry Room Ideas

A dog washing station in your laundry room is a game-changer for pet owners. It provides a dedicated, convenient space to bathe muddy dogs without messing up your bathroom. By combining pet care with laundry functions, you save time and keep messes contained. From walk-in showers and elevated tubs to handheld sprayers and built-in drying stations, here are twelve dog washing station in laundry room ideas to inspire your next project.

1. Walk-In Shower Station

Convert a corner of your laundry room into a walk-in shower for your dog. Use waterproof tile or fiberglass panels on the walls and floor. Install a handheld showerhead on a sliding bar for easy use. Add a glass door or a curtain to contain splashes. This design is ideal for large dogs.

2. Elevated Tub Station

Install an elevated stainless steel or fiberglass tub for washing your dog at a comfortable height. The tub should have a non-slip surface and a drain connected to your plumbing. Add a handheld sprayer and a ramp or steps for your dog to climb up. Use the space under the tub for storing dog shampoo, towels, and brushes.

3. Utility Sink Conversion

Convert a deep utility sink into a dog washing station. A large, deep sink works well for small to medium dogs. Add a handheld sprayer to the faucet and a non-slip mat to the bottom of the sink. Store dog supplies on a shelf or in a cabinet beside the sink.

4. Tiled Alcove with Glass Door

Create a dedicated tiled alcove for dog washing. Use waterproof tile on the walls and floor. Install a handheld showerhead and a glass door or curtain. The alcove can be built into existing cabinetry or into a corner. This design keeps water contained and looks built-in.

5. Roll-Away Dog Tub

A roll-away dog tub is a flexible solution for small laundry rooms. The tub is on casters so you can roll it out when needed and tuck it away when not in use. Choose a tub with a drain hose that can empty into a nearby floor drain or utility sink.

6. Fold-Down Washing Station

Install a fold-down washing station that mounts to the wall. When not in use, it folds flat against the wall. When needed, fold it down to reveal a tub and sprayer. This is an excellent space-saving solution for very small laundry rooms.

7. Laundry Room Mudroom Combo with Dog Wash

Combine your laundry room with a mudroom and a dog washing station. Include a tiled area with a handheld sprayer and floor drain. Add hooks for leashes and towels, a bench for putting on boots, and cabinets for supplies. This is the ultimate pet-friendly entryway.

8. Raised Platform with Grate

Build a raised platform with a grate for washing your dog. The grate lifts the dog off the floor and allows water to drain away. Use waterproof materials like tile or sealed concrete. Add a handheld sprayer and a ramp for easy access. This design is especially good for large, heavy dogs.

9. Handheld Sprayer at Existing Utility Sink

If you already have a utility sink, simply add a handheld sprayer to the faucet. This is the most affordable and easiest option. Add a non-slip mat to the sink bottom. Use a detachable sprayer that can be stored when not in use. This works well for small dogs.

10. Dog Drying Station

Add a dedicated drying station beside your washing station. Use a wall-mounted pet dryer or a simple hook for a towel. Add a non-slip mat for your dog to stand on. Store towels and a brush in a nearby cabinet. The drying station completes the grooming process.

11. Cabinet with Pull-Out Tub

Build a custom cabinet with a pull-out dog tub. The tub slides out like a drawer when needed and slides back in when not in use. This is an excellent space-saving solution for small laundry rooms. The tub can be made of stainless steel or heavy-duty plastic.

12. Heated Dog Wash Station

If you live in a cold climate, add a heating element to your dog wash station. Use a heated water supply or a small space heater in the area. Warm water makes bath time more comfortable for your dog. Heated floors are another luxury option.
